Position Summary

We are seeking a compassionate and skilled Occupational Therapist (OTR) to join our rehabilitation team on a PRN basis.

In this role, you will evaluate and treat residents, develop individualized treatment plans, and work closely with residents, families, physicians, and interdisciplinary team members to maximize independence and quality of life.
Key Responsibilities


* Evaluate residents and develop individualized occupational therapy treatment plans


* Provide skilled occupational therapy services in accordance with physician orders and resident goals


* Monitor resident progress and adjust treatment plans as needed


* Collaborate with physicians, nursing staff, residents, families, and interdisciplinary team members


* Participate in care plan meetings, rehabilitation conferences, and discharge planning activities


* Complete accurate and timely documentation in accordance with facility, state, federal, and payer requirements


* Educate residents, families, and caregivers on treatment plans, adaptive techniques, and maintenance programs


* Recommend adaptive equipment and interventions to improve resident function and safety


* Conduct in-service training and education for facility staff as needed


* Maintain compliance with all facility policies, state practice acts, and regulatory requirements


* Promote resident safety, independence, and overall well-being
